Alaska Bible College vs. Johnson & Wales University-Charlotte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Alaska Bible College or Johnson & Wales University-Charlotte?

  • Johnson & Wales University Charlotte is 271.5% more expensive to attend than Alaska Bible College for in-state tuition ($37,896.00 vs. $10,200.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 271.5% higher at Johnson & Wales University-Charlotte than Alaska Bible College ($37,896.00 vs. $10,200.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Alaska Bible College than Johnson & Wales University-Charlotte ($17,156 vs. $29,238)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Alaska Bible College are 112.5% lower than costs at Johnson & Wales University Charlotte ($7,000 vs. $14,876)
  • The same percent of students receive financial grant aid at Alaska Bible College as Johnson & Wales University Charlotte (100% vs. 100%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Johnson & Wales University Charlotte students is 485.8% larger than aid received Alaska Bible College ($28,061 vs. $4,790)
